Heirloom Tomato Salad with Balsamic

Description

A heart healthy recipe based on the traditional Mediterranean diet. Summer usually brings a bounty of tomatoes and this is a classic simple way to enjoy them. If you cannot find heirloom tomatoes fell free to use any type. Look for those which are firm and not over-ripe or they may fall apart. Another way to keep this from happening is to make the slices a little thicker.

Ingredients:

1/4 cup Extra Virgin Olive Oil - unflavored
2 tablespoons Sweet White Balsamic Vinegar
1 teaspoon Cask Aged 10 or 25 Year Balsamic Vinegar for drizzle
1/2 teaspoon French Fleur de Sel Sea Salt
1/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
1/2 teaspoon Italian Seasoning Blend
2 pounds heirloom tomatoes sliced
1 pint cherry tomatoes halved
1/2 cup fresh basil leaves roughly chopped or torn

Directions:

Whisk the olive oil, vinegar, sea salt, pepper and Italian Seasoning together in a large mixing bowl.

Add the tomatoes and fresh herbs to the bowl and gently toss until combined.

Allow the salad to marinate for at least 15 -20 minutes.

Arrange tomato slices on a serving dish and pour remaining marinade over the top.

Finish with a delicate drizzle of dark balsamic before serving.
